What companies run services between Casper, WY, USA and Colorado, USA?

Express Arrow operates a bus from Casper Amtrak Station to Denver Union Station 4 times a week. Tickets cost $80–95 and the journey takes 6h 5m. Alternatively, United Airlines flies from Casper (CPR) to Colorado Springs Airport (COS) 5 times a day.
